Understanding Modern Web Applications

Many of today's websites utilize modern web applications which use third-party scripts which are loaded from external servers. These scripts are often allowed to make changes to the embedding page and access resources on the server of the site using it. If something goes wrong with such a script on your website and you do not have the proper website monitoring service set up, your site may, at first glance, look like working properly. However, whenever a user tries to really access and navigate your site, the script may cause a less-than-ideal experience.

Your Site Is A lot more than the Server It's Hosted On

If you are using any third-party scripts or other third-party tools on your own site, embedded in your site's pages but hosted on another server, you have to remember that your site's up-time is affected by more than just the up-time of one's hosting provider. The up-time of your site is also affected by the up-time of the technology that you use within your site's pages. As such, you need to make sure you utilize a website monitoring service that may monitor all areas of your site and not simply the up-time of one's site's hosting server.
